Who is Agustin Tapia?

The N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K bears the signature of Agustin Tapia, one of the most electrifying and talented players in professional padel today. Known as the “Mozart of Catamarca” for his artistic and precise playing style, Tapia has become a household name in the padel world through his exceptional court vision, devastating power, and innovative shot-making ability.

At just 25 years old, Tapia has already achieved remarkable success on the World Padel Tour, consistently ranking among the top players globally. His left-handed playing style, combined with his explosive athleticism and tactical intelligence, has made him one of the most feared competitors on the professional circuit.

Technical Specifications: The Foundation of Excellence

Let me break down the technical specifications that make the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K such a formidable piece of equipment:

Core Construction
  • Material: MLD Black EVA core
  • Density: Medium-hard compound
  • Weight: 360-375 grams
  • Balance: High (head-heavy configuration)
  • Shape: Teardrop design

 

Face Technology
  • Material: Premium 12K carbon fiber
  • Surface: Dual-texture finish with 3D hexagonal pattern
  • Technology: Exclusive Spin technology
  • Thickness: 38mm frame width

 

Advanced Features
  • NOX Custom Grip technology (52% increased grip, 29% vibration reduction)
  • EOS Flap aerodynamic enhancement
  • Smartstrap system for customizable safety
  • Testea Padel quality certification

The teardrop shape is particularly noteworthy. This design choice isn’t arbitrary – it’s engineered to provide the perfect balance between power and control. The wider head allows for a larger sweet spot, while the narrower handle section enhances maneuverability during quick exchanges at the net.

Technology Deep Dive: Innovation in Action

12K Carbon Fiber: The Foundation of Performance

The 12K carbon fiber construction represents the cutting edge of racket technology. This high-density weave provides exceptional stiffness and durability while maintaining the responsiveness needed for elite-level play. The carbon fibers are arranged in a specific pattern that maximizes strength while minimizing weight, creating the ideal platform for power generation.

The 12K weave is significantly more advanced than traditional carbon fiber constructions. It offers superior fatigue resistance, meaning the racket maintains its performance characteristics even after thousands of hits. This consistency is crucial for serious players who demand reliability from their equipment.

MLD Black EVA Core: The Heart of the Racket

The Multi-Layer Density (MLD) Black EVA core is a marvel of engineering. This proprietary foam combines multiple density layers to create a core that provides both power and control. The varying densities work together to optimize ball contact time, providing the perfect balance between responsiveness and feel.

The black coloring isn’t just aesthetic – it represents an advanced formulation that maintains its properties across different temperature ranges. Whether you’re playing in cold morning conditions or hot afternoon sun, the core performs consistently.

Exclusive Spin Technology: Revolutionizing Shot Making

The dual-texture surface treatment is perhaps the most innovative feature of the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K. The 3D hexagonal pattern in the sweet spot creates optimal friction for maximum spin generation, while the sandy texture on the outer areas provides versatility for different types of spin.

This technology allows players to impart more rotation on the ball than ever before. The increased spin not only makes shots more difficult to return but also provides a larger margin for error, as the additional rotation helps bring aggressive shots down into the court.

EOS Flap Aerodynamics: Cutting Through the Air

The EOS Flap technology optimizes the racket’s aerodynamic properties, reducing air resistance during the swing. This might seem like a minor detail, but the cumulative effect over hundreds of swings during a match is significant. Faster swing speeds translate to more power and quicker recovery between shots.

The aerodynamic enhancements also contribute to the racket’s exceptional maneuverability. Despite its power-oriented design, the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K feels surprisingly agile, allowing for quick adjustments and rapid-fire volleys at the net.

Comparison with Competition: Standing Above the Rest

Versus Head Delta Pro

The Head Delta Pro is often considered the benchmark for power rackets, but the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K offers several advantages. While both rackets provide exceptional power, the NOX offering provides superior spin capabilities and better vibration dampening. The N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K also offers a more comfortable playing experience during extended sessions.

Versus Bullpadel Vertex 04

The popular Bullpadel Vertex 04 is known for its control-oriented design, but the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K manages to match its precision while providing significantly more power. The NOX racket’s spin generation capabilities are also superior, making it more versatile across different playing styles.

Versus Adidas Metalbone 3.4

The Adidas Metalbone 3.4 is renowned for its power, but it can be demanding on the arm during long sessions. The N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K provides comparable power with superior comfort, making it the better choice for players who prioritize both performance and long-term playability.

Player Profile: Who Should Choose the N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K

Ideal Player Characteristics

The N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K is best suited for intermediate to advanced players who want to take their game to the next level. If you have solid fundamental technique and are looking for a racket that can amplify your skills, this is an excellent choice. The racket rewards good technique while being forgiving enough to help you through the learning process.

Perfect for:
  • Intermediate players ready to upgrade their equipment
  • Advanced players seeking power without sacrificing control
  • Aggressive baseline players who like to dictate rallies
  • Players who value both performance and comfort
  • Tournament competitors who need consistent performance

 

Consider alternatives if:
  • You’re a complete beginner (the power might be overwhelming)
  • You prefer ultra-light rackets (under 350g)
  • You have a very slow swing speed
  • You primarily play defensive padel
  • Budget is a primary concern

 

Playing Style Compatibility

The NOX AT10 GENIUS 12K excels with aggressive, power-based playing styles. If you like to take control of points early and finish them decisively, this racket will amplify your natural tendencies. The enhanced spin capabilities also make it excellent for players who like to use rotation to create angles and move opponents around the court.

However, the racket is versatile enough to accommodate different styles. Defensive players will appreciate the excellent control characteristics, while all-court players will love the versatility that allows them to adapt their game based on match situations.
